The woodlands of Japan vary substantially from north to south, and the patterns of their use and abuse differed from area to area during the Edo, or early modern, period (1600–1868). Nevertheless, the basic characteristics and rhythms of forest history were common to all of Japan (except the sparsely populated northern island of Hokkaidō). It is possible, therefore, to illuminate the general experience by scrutinizing a section of the whole. The section selected here is Akita, a prefecture of northern Japan whose forests are among the nation’s most famous. Three considerations make this choice attractive. The topic has clearly delineated boundaries, largely because the Akita region was a single coherent political unit during the Edo period; the documentation on the early modern forest situation there is extensive and accessible; finally, and as a consequence of the second factor, Japanese scholars have already published excellent studies on key aspects of Akita forestry. These factors have made this a relatively convenient area to examine and discuss in the short compass of this study.

Excerpt from Forestry of Japan This work aims to give an adequate idea of forestry in Japan, and treats of State, Crown, and private forests. More attention is naturally given to State and Crown forests on account of the insufficiency of information about private forests. All the data were prepared by the Department of Agriculture and Commerce being mostly taken from report for 1902, when the data for that year were not available, the reports for 1903 or 1901 were used, preference being given to the later year. As the units of distance, ri, cho, ken, and shaku have been used, equivalent to about 21/2 miles, 1,200 yards, 6 ft. and 1 ft. respectively. The unit of capacity is the koku, equivalent to 181 litres. The unit of weight is the kin, which is almost equal to 1 lbs. The unit of area is the cho, equal to about 21/2 acres. The unit for measuring timber is the shakujime, equivalent to 12 cu. ft., and that for fuel wood is the tana, or 72 cubic ft. The monetary unit is the yen, equal to about $0.50 U.S. gold. In many cases, the dates are given according to the Japanese system the first year of Meiji being 1868. All the reports are made for the fiscal year which extending from April 1st to March 31st. The common Japanese names of trees together with the botanical ones are given. About the Publisher Forgotten Books publishes hundreds of thousands of rare and classic books. Riparian forests along streams and rivers are diverse in species, structure, and regeneration processes, and have important ecological functions in maintaining landscape and biodiversity. This book discusses riparian forests from subpolar to warm-temperate zones, covering headwater streams, braided rivers on alluvial fans, and low-gradient meandering rivers. It presents the dynamics and mechanisms that govern the coexistence of riparian tree species, tree demography, the response to water stress of trees, and the conservation of endangered species, and focuses on natural disturbances, life-history strategies, and the ecophysiology of trees. Because many riparian landscapes have been degraded and are disappearing at an alarming rate, the regeneration of the remaining riparian ecosystems is urgent. With contributions by more than 20 experts in diverse fields, this book offers useful information for the conservation, restoration, and rehabilitation of riparian ecosystems that remain in world streams and rivers.

This book is the first to analyze the environmental impact of Japanese trade, corporations, and aid on timber management in the context of Southeast Asian political economies. It is also one of the first comprehensive studies of why Southeast Asian states are unable to enforce forest policies and regulations.
